Ahh....it's good to be back!
Mini-Combz has seemingly been a little in the slumps for a couple of months with attendence on the decline, but last night, we returned to our full glory. I believe the final head count was somewhere around 23-25. We had a couple of new faces, some faces that we hadn't seen in a while, and plenty of regulars to hand out the regular dose of virtual beatings.
Surprisingly, Call of Duty didn't make much of an appearance at this event. The games that ruled the night were Warcraft 3 (both Panda Tag and 3 Corridors), Desert Combat (OLD SCHOOL!), and Age of Empires 2. As usual there were other games played as well, but these seemed to be the primary ones that received the most attention. Also, a couple of our attendees brought their Nintendo Wii's with them, and we set them up on a projector on the main wall. It added a pretty fun way to pass the time between PC games.
